如何实现CDN的伪静态配置以优化网站性能?
- 行业动态
- 2024-08-14
- 1
CDN伪静态是一种通过内容分发网络(CDN)实现的URL重写技术,它将动态生成的网页地址转换为看起来像静态页面的URL。这样做可以优化搜索引擎对网站的抓取和索引,同时提高用户体验,因为它隐藏了实际的技术实现细节。
在当今数字化时代,网站的速度和性能对于吸引和保持用户至关重要,为了优化用户体验,许多网站运用CDN(内容分发网络)技术来加速内容的分发。【伪静态】处理,即通过URL重写技术将动态页面的URL模拟为静态页面的URL格式,既保留了动态页面的灵活性,又兼具了静态页面URL的简洁性,下面是详细解析这两者的结合使用,以期达到最佳的网站性能提升:
1、基础概念理解
CDN工作原理:CDN服务通过将网站内容缓存到遍布全球的多个节点服务器上,使用户可以就近获取所需内容,从而减少延迟和加载时间。
伪静态定义:伪静态是一种将动态网页的URL制作成静态网页URL样的技术,在不改变网站原有动态结构的前提下,通过URL重写,使得链接看起来更像静态HTML页面的URL。
2、伪静态与CDN结合的优势
提高访问速度:将伪静态站点通过CDN加速,可以利用CDN的边缘缓存功能,加快全球用户的访问速度。
降低服务器压力:CDN缓存能够显著减少源服务器的请求压力,尤其是对于高流量的网站而言尤为重要。
3、缓存规则自定义
的处理:由于伪静态页面可能包含动态数据,需要正确配置CDN缓存规则,确保用户总是接收到最新的内容。
智能缓存策略:根据资源的变动频率和重要性,设定不同的缓存时间和缓存层级,以达到最优的加载平衡。
4、CDN选择与配置
全站加速:对于包含大量动态或伪静态资源的站点,选用支持全站加速的CDN服务更为合适,可有效提升动态页面的加载速度。
配置SSL/TLS:为了安全传输,CDN配置中应包括SSL/TLS证书的管理,确保数据传输的安全性。
5、伪静态页面的优化
URL重写规则:合理设置URL重写规则,使得伪静态页面的URL结构清晰、有序,便于CDN进行缓存和分发。
识别:CDN能够识别纯静态与伪静态页面,对伪静态页面采取直回源策略,保证内容的实时更新。
在深入探讨了CDN与伪静态结合使用的技术细节后,还需要考虑以下因素以确保最佳实践:
确保CDN服务商提供良好的客户服务和技术支持,以便在遇到问题时能够迅速获得帮助。
监控CDN性能,定期检查其运行状态,及时调整配置以应对流量变化。
考虑成本效益比,选择性价比高的CDN服务,避免不必要的资源浪费。
CDN与伪静态的结合使用不仅能够显著提升网站的访问速度和用户体验,还能有效降低服务器负载,是现代网站设计与运营中不可或缺的一环,通过上述的详细讨论,了解到实现这一目标需要综合考虑技术选型、配置优化以及成本管理等多个方面。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/53121.html